Price and efficiency are key factors when choosing a car – and this is often where the real differences emerge.
Ford Transit Courier is substantially cheaper – starting at 20,700 £ , while the Renault Mégane costs 35,100 £ . That’s a price difference of around 14,402 £.
In terms of energy consumption, the Renault Mégane is moderately more efficient: consuming 15.4 kWh/100km compared to 17.7 kWh/100km for the Ford Transit Courier. That’s a difference of about 2.3 kWh/100km.
As for electric range, the Renault Mégane offers markedly more range – reaching up to 452 km, about 127 km more than the Ford Transit Courier.
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.
When it comes to engine power, the Renault Mégane offers clearly more power – delivering 218 HP compared to 136 HP. That’s roughly 82 HP more horsepower.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Renault Mégane delivers marginally more torque with 300 Nm compared to 290 Nm. That’s about 10 Nm more.
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In terms of curb weight, Ford Transit Courier is markedly lighter – 1,378 kg compared to 1,719 kg. The difference is around 341 kg.
When it comes to payload, the Ford Transit Courier carries clearly more – 701 kg compared to 446 kg. That’s a difference of about 255 kg.
